What happens to acyclovir in the kidneys?

Acyclovir is cleared mainly by the kidneys. If kidney function is reduced, acyclovir can build up in the body, raising the risk of kidney injury and other side effects. This is why dosing often needs adjustment in people with chronic kidney disease or in anyone who develops an acute decline in kidney function.

Can acyclovir cause kidney problems?

Yes. Acyclovir can cause kidney injury, particularly if:
- it accumulates due to reduced renal clearance, or
- high drug concentrations occur (for example, with inadequate hydration or certain route/dosing choices).

Because of that risk, clinicians typically monitor kidney function (blood tests) and adjust dose based on creatinine clearance or estimated glomerular filtration rate.

How do clinicians adjust acyclovir dosing for kidney disease?

Dose adjustment is based on how well the kidneys filter blood (kidney function measures such as creatinine clearance/eGFR). In general, lower doses or longer dosing intervals may be used when kidney function is impaired, to prevent toxic accumulation.

What symptoms or lab changes might suggest a kidney issue?

Signs that can prompt evaluation include:
- reduced urine output
- new or worsening swelling or fatigue
- rising serum creatinine on bloodwork

If kidney function worsens during treatment, clinicians typically stop and/or adjust acyclovir and evaluate other contributing factors.

Are there safer alternatives for people with kidney impairment?

Sometimes. If acyclovir dosing would be unsafe or difficult to manage in kidney disease, clinicians may consider alternative antiviral regimens and will still base choices and doses on renal function.

Does route matter (oral vs IV)?

Kidney risk is generally most concerning with higher systemic exposure. IV dosing can create higher blood levels, so renal monitoring and hydration strategies are especially important when acyclovir is given intravenously. Oral dosing still requires adjustment when kidney function is reduced.

What other kidney-risk factors interact with acyclovir?

Risk can increase with other factors that stress the kidneys, such as dehydration and concurrent use of other kidney-impacting medicines. Clinicians review the full medication list and hydration status and may request more frequent lab monitoring.
